question text To ask Her Majesty’s Government, further to the Written Answer by Baroness Anelay of St Johns on 4 December (HL3192), what is their assessment of the use of live fire for crowd control. more like this

answer text In our conversations with Israeli interlocutors including the Israeli Police and the Israeli Defense Force, we urge investigations into all incidents of the use of live fire for crowd control. We are aware of the rise in the number of deaths resulting from live fire – in comparison to last year – and consistently and regularly encourage restraint in our follow-up on related incidents. more like this

question text To ask Her Majesty’s Government, further to the Written Answer by Baroness Northover on 1 December (HL2862), whether Palestinian farmers have received compensation for their loss of fruit trees; and if so, from whom. more like this

answer text <p>Palestinian farmers have not been systematically compensated for fruit trees destroyed as a result of settler violence. However, the Palestinian Authority’s Committee Against the Wall and Settlements has provided small amounts of compensation on an ad hoc basis to some Palestinian farmers affected by settlement activities in the West Bank. The UK continues to raise concerns about incidents of settler violence with the Israeli authorities.</p><p> </p> more like this
